What affects the price

Handyman rates generally depend on the scope of your project, the quality of materials selected, and how much time the repair takes. Complex jobs involving structural work, specialized electrical, or plumbing upgrades usually push costs higher than simple furniture assembly or minor patching. If you have specific parts already purchased, that can lower labor time. Because every home has different needs, we don't provide flat rates online.

What are some red flags when hiring a handyman in Santa Rosa?

Be cautious if a handyman in Santa Rosa asks for full payment upfront or can't provide references. Unclear pricing or a reluctance to offer a written estimate are also warning signs. Ensure they are licensed and insured to protect yourself and your property.
